When connecting the PTO from the tractor to the chaser bin, the PTO shaft may need to be cut to ensure it is the correct length. If the shaft is too long, it can bottom out causing damage telescopic sections and connecting components. If it is too short, it may disengage when the tractor moves through peaks and troughs.
